Tailored commercial gate solutions


At BestSteel, we understand that every business is unique and each property has its own set of requirements. That's why we work closely with you, from start to finish, to craft a custom-built solution tailored to your needs.

Whether you want to install automatic gates to make to make entry and exit easier, need your gate to open around a curve due to your site layout or want to add extra features such as smartphone or intercom access, we can accommodate you.

We also offer a range of finishes including steel, which can be powder coated to a colour of your choice, and timber panels.

Proven processes for long-lasting installations


We understand that commercial gates need to be hard-wearing and withstand a lot of use as well as the New Zealand weather. So, every gate we create receives ‘hot-dip’ galvanising. This resilient coating protects not only the steel but also the welded areas of the structure. We back this with an eight-year no-rust warranty alongside our six-year workmanship guarantee.
